What is Generative AI?

Generative AI is a type of artificial intelligence capable of creating original content, whether it be text, images, audio, video, or even code. Unlike traditional AI systems, which focus on analyzing data and making decisions based on pre-existing patterns, Generative AI goes a step further. It can understand user instructions and generate unique content tailored to their specific needs.

How does Generative AI work?

At the core of Generative AI are artificial neural networks, particularly generative models. One of the most well-known examples is Large Language Models (LLMs), such as ChatGPT, which learn from vast amounts of data. These models identify patterns and structures to generate content that mimics the material they’ve been trained on, but without reproducing it exactly.

The process begins with model training. Once trained, the system can interpret user instructions and create coherent and context-adapted content. Thanks to this capability, Generative AI is prepared to tackle a wide range of tasks.

Types of Generative AI

There are different types of Generative AI, depending on the kind of content they can produce:

  • Language models: Used to generate text, answer questions, draft articles, emails, reports, and more.
  • Image models: Ideal for creating illustrations, graphic designs, and visual content in various styles.
  • Audio models: Capable of generating music, sound effects, or realistic voices.
  • Video models: Although still under development, they can produce visual sequences for audiovisual content and animations.
  • Code models: Tools like GitHub Copilot enable developers to create lines of code and troubleshoot programming issues.
  • 3D models: Used in fields like architecture, industrial design, or video games to create three-dimensional objects and environments.

Popular Generative AI Tools

Some of the most well-known tools in this field include:

  • ChatGPT (OpenAI): Ideal for generating text and holding conversations.
  • DALL·E (OpenAI): Specialized in creating images from text.
  • MidJourney: A tool for designers and graphic artists.
  • Runway ML: Creates audiovisual content for advertising.
  • GitHub Copilot: A programming assistant for developers.
  • Stable Diffusion: Open-source image generation.
  • Synthesia: Creates explanatory videos with AI-generated avatars.
